Comprehending the Allure of Fake Products
1. Cost-Effectiveness
Among the main factors customers select fake items is the substantial expense savings. Genuine high-end products can bring significant price, making them financially out of reach for many. Counterfeit versions often cost a portion of the expense, supplying an attractive option for those who want the aesthetic of high-end brands without the accompanying cost.
2. Pattern Accessibility
Style trends frequently shift rapidly, triggering consumers to purchase current styles. Nevertheless, buying authentic designer products for each brand-new season can be financially impractical. Fake items enable people to remain on trend without breaking the bank, making them especially attracting more youthful customers and those with limited budget plans.
3. Social Status
In lots of cultures, the ownership of high-end brand names is associated with social status and status. Counterfeit items can provide a semblance of this status, making it possible for people to forecast an image of wealth and success without the accompanying financial concern of authentic items.
The Implications of Buying Fakes
1. Economic Impact
While counterfeit items might offer a short-term financial advantage to customers, the wider financial implications are considerable. The counterfeit industry undermines genuine services, resulting in lost sales and damage to brand reputation. According to reports from the International Chamber of Commerce, the overall financial value lost due to counterfeiting and piracy might reach over $4.2 trillion by 2022, affecting job markets and state incomes worldwide.
2. Safety and Quality Concerns
Counterfeit items often lack the quality and safety assurance of genuine products. Products like electronics, cosmetics, and pharmaceuticals might posture health dangers, as they do not undergo standard security testing or quality assurance procedures. For example, counterfeit cosmetics can contain harmful chemicals, while fake electronics might posture fire risks due to inferior products.
3. Ethical Considerations

The purchasing and selling of fake products raise ethical concerns surrounding labor practices and environmental effects. Counterfeit goods are frequently produced in environments that exploit employees, providing low salaries and poor working conditions. Furthermore, the production of these products normally includes minimal regard for ecological sustainability.
How to Spot Fake Products
For customers wary of buying counterfeit items, finding out to recognize fakes is important. Here are several suggestions to assist prevent falling victim to counterfeiters:
1. Research study the Retailer
Validate authenticity: Seek retailers with established credibilities and favorable customer reviews.
Look for main collaborations: Authentic brands generally have actually designated sellers or authorized car dealerships.
2. Evaluate Prices
Too great to be real: If an offer appears excessively inexpensive compared to standard market prices, proceed with care; it's likely a fake.
Price consistency: Compare costs throughout numerous sites to assess what a fair market worth should be.
3. Inspect Product Details
Quality and workmanship: Genuine items normally have premium finishes, sewing, and products. Examine logo designs and labels for accuracy.
Product packaging: Authentic products often are available in branded packaging with security functions (e.g., holograms).
4. Seek Legal Channels
Licensing information: Reliable products frequently feature evidence of authenticity, such as serial numbers or authenticity cards.
Return policies: Check for affordable return policies, as trustworthy sellers need to provide the choice to return undesirable or defective products.
Alternatives to Buying Fakes
For customers who prefer cost-effective choices without risking the pitfalls of counterfeit items, think about looking for options:
1. Second-Hand and Vintage Items
Buying used high-end products can provide access to authentic items at lower costs. Thrift shops, online markets, and consignment shops frequently provide designer items without the premium cost.
2. Affordable Brands
Many brand names concentrate on creating premium items that emulate luxury designs without the associated expenses. Investigating these brands can yield elegant choices without compromising principles.
3. Do it yourself Projects
For the creatively likely, crafting or tailoring products can often offer both a satisfying experience and a special item that prevents the counterfeit problem.
